As the UK's leading private provider of laser eye, premium intraocular lens and cataract surgery, our expert Surgeons undertake more procedures collectively than any other national provider. For over 35 years, millions of patients have trusted Optical Express with their eye care. We are focused on delivering exceptional patient care, outstanding clinical outcomes and continued investment in our people and technology.
A fantastic opportunity has become available for an optometrist to provide care to patients from our clinic in Bristol. You will work as part of a multi-disciplinary team alongside experienced eye care professionals, including ophthalmologists, and play a crucial role in the delivery of a diverse range of clinical eye care services to our patients.
Your role will be varied and can include:
- Pre- and post-operative consultations for our refractive and cataract surgery patients.
- Providing clinical support to our ophthalmologists.
- Being part of our multi-disciplinary YAG capsulotomy service, delivering these procedures.
- Providing Essential and Advanced Eye Examinations for our patients.

We offer an array of flexible working patterns to suit your lifestyle, to include longer hours across fewer days and patterns that support your family or lifestyle commitments. Full and part time opportunities are available. Relocation allowances will be considered.
Optical Express is committed to providing clinicians and patients alike with access to state of the art diagnostic and treatment technologies from a range of market leaders such as Carl Zeiss and Johnson & Johnson Vision. Full refractive and cataract surgery training will be provided and is delivered by experienced clinicians. To ensure you have maximum support day-to-day in the clinic, you will work alongside an exceptional professional team, as well as having access to invaluable guidance from the Clinical Services team, which includes some of the most experienced optometrists and ophthalmologists in the specialist areas of refractive surgery and cataract care.
